Top definition
derogatory term used in predominantly Black Muslim communities for someone who is acting too Arabic.
Stop being such a mustafa azziq! what are you going to do next, put a towel on your head?
by Shafaka April 22, 2004
Get the mug
Get a mustafa azziq mug for your mother-in-law Rihanna.